**Ticket: Encoding detection drift on FileHarbor upload nodes**

Flagging this for security review since it touches untrusted input handling. The encoding sniffer on the Dunmore upload nodes has drifted from the hardened baseline — someone bumped the confidence threshold and re-enabled the legacy charset fallback during the Pexley hotfix, and it stuck. That fallback is exactly what let mislabeled UTF-7 files slip past filtering last year, so yeah, not great. Please review before we reconcile. Here's what the nodes are currently running.

deployment values, yadug-bawif:
[framir]
team = pelox
access_code = ac_a38ab2
owner = tamion.julael
host = framir.tolvaqlabs.test
port = 11211
peer = tammir.zemvargrid.local
salt = 2215ef03
pin = 1541

Subject: Key rotation — Scanbright integration

Rotating the Scanbright barcode-scanner service key today. Old key dies at 18:00. Update the client config in your review branch before approving the integration PR; tests will fail otherwise. No other changes to the endpoint or payload format. The replacement key for the internal scanner gateway follows below.

gateway credential: kto11_pTkcHgLwuNE

Context for the security reviewer: the Dunmore scheduling service double-booked the ceremony room because two sync agents wrote conflicting events. Before signing off, confirm the conflict was resolved by deleting the phantom event, not by muting the sync agent. Verify the audit trail shows exactly one ceremony slot and that both custodians acknowledged the corrected time. The sync agent's config vault was sealed after the incident; to inspect its state, unseal it with the recovery passphrase below.

vault phrase of tajeg-tageg = pelix-druix-holius-briael-zorwyn-frawyn-fraox-norok-drueth-aldiel

Fan-out backpressure for the Quillet notifier: when the queue depth crosses the soft limit, the dispatcher sheds low-priority pushes and batches the rest at 500ms intervals. Reviewer should confirm the shed counter is exported and that retries respect the jitter window. Once merged, the release artifact gets re-signed by the pipeline, which expects the deploy key shown below.

deploy key for bawep-yawif: bky6_GQhaSt